Ownner #41 15 января 2013 (изменено) помоги себе сам Изменено 15 января 2013 пользователем Ownner <33 Поделиться сообщением Ссылка на сообщение
F1sher #42 15 января 2013 Софи, сходи в туалет, сфоткай сиськи побыстрому, выложи сюда и я быстренько напишу тебе Би май дарлинг http://www.youtube.com/watch?v=LhkUjA3D8ig Поделиться сообщением Ссылка на сообщение
~Sofi #43 15 января 2013 Сори, но тока Си проходил, и то 5 лет назад. Рубиш вроде программер, ему в личку попробуй написать.он меня хейт вродеты ахуела на экзамене пданиться?не пданилась уже давно, можно и на экзамене попданиться, темболее жду помощи от няш Поделиться сообщением Ссылка на сообщение
Хазард #44 15 января 2013 помогу если обещаешь больше не заходить на этот сайт Поделиться сообщением Ссылка на сообщение
Flamenko #45 15 января 2013 помогу если обещаешь больше не заходить на этот сайтистинный джентельмен Поделиться сообщением Ссылка на сообщение
~Sofi #46 15 января 2013 помогу если обещаешь больше не заходить на этот сайтдавай уже Поделиться сообщением Ссылка на сообщение
KotZhilkina #47 15 января 2013 Option Compare Database Option Explicit Option Base 1 '3,1,5,7,2 --> 1,5,7,2,3 Public TestArray() As Variant Public Sub T() Call FillArray(TestArray()) Call ShiftArray(TestArray()) End Sub Public Sub FillArray(ByRef InputArray() As Variant) Const l As Long = 5 ReDim InputArray(l) Dim i As Long i = i + 1: InputArray(i) = 3 i = i + 1: InputArray(i) = 1 i = i + 1: InputArray(i) = 5 i = i + 1: InputArray(i) = 7 i = i + 1: InputArray(i) = 2 End Sub Public Sub ShiftArray(ByRef InputArray() As Variant) Dim i_min As Long Dim i_max As Long Dim i As Long i_min = LBound(InputArray()) i_max = UBound(InputArray()) Dim v_min As Variant Dim v_max As Variant Dim v As Variant v_min = InputArray(i_min) v_max = InputArray(i_max) 'Debug.Print i_min, i_max, v_min, v_max For i = i_min To i_max Select Case i Case i_max: v = v_min Case Else: v = InputArray(i + 1) End Select InputArray(i) = v 'Debug.Print v_min, v_max, v, InputArray(i) Next End Sub Публикация отключена Поделиться сообщением Ссылка на сообщение
healms #48 15 января 2013 Прогиб засчитан. «Нам блять нахуй Путин сказал, ебашить их нахуй» vpn1 vpn2 vpn3 Поделиться сообщением Ссылка на сообщение
max.mad #49 15 января 2013 Прогиб засчитан.Барян ты сёдня какой-то грустный Поделиться сообщением Ссылка на сообщение
~Sofi #50 15 января 2013 Option Compare Database Option Explicit Option Base 1 '3,1,5,7,2 --> 1,5,7,2,3 Public TestArray() As Variant Public Sub T() Call FillArray(TestArray()) Call ShiftArray(TestArray()) End Sub Public Sub FillArray(ByRef InputArray() As Variant) Const l As Long = 5 ReDim InputArray(l) Dim i As Long i = i + 1: InputArray(i) = 3 i = i + 1: InputArray(i) = 1 i = i + 1: InputArray(i) = 5 i = i + 1: InputArray(i) = 7 i = i + 1: InputArray(i) = 2 End Sub Public Sub ShiftArray(ByRef InputArray() As Variant) Dim i_min As Long Dim i_max As Long Dim i As Long i_min = LBound(InputArray()) i_max = UBound(InputArray()) Dim v_min As Variant Dim v_max As Variant Dim v As Variant v_min = InputArray(i_min) v_max = InputArray(i_max) 'Debug.Print i_min, i_max, v_min, v_max For i = i_min To i_max Select Case i Case i_max: v = v_min Case Else: v = InputArray(i + 1) End Select InputArray(i) = v 'Debug.Print v_min, v_max, v, InputArray(i) Next End Sub выдает ерор синтаксиса втф :O Поделиться сообщением Ссылка на сообщение
F1sher #51 15 января 2013 '3,1,5,7,2 --> 1,5,7,2,3 - это убери в какой строке еррор? Би май дарлинг http://www.youtube.com/watch?v=LhkUjA3D8ig Поделиться сообщением Ссылка на сообщение
KotZhilkina #53 15 января 2013 Option Compare Database доступно только в Access Публикация отключена Поделиться сообщением Ссылка на сообщение
healms #54 15 января 2013 Прогиб засчитан.Барян ты сёдня какой-то грустныйДень такой. «Нам блять нахуй Путин сказал, ебашить их нахуй» vpn1 vpn2 vpn3 Поделиться сообщением Ссылка на сообщение
~Sofi #55 15 января 2013 '3,1,5,7,2 --> 1,5,7,2,3 - это убери в какой строке еррор?бля не смешно, мне уже вот вот программу показывать, а вы тут шуточки шутите Поделиться сообщением Ссылка на сообщение
XpoHuK #56 15 января 2013 НАХУЙ ПОШЛА, БЛЯДИНА. https://www.twitch.tv/alcorithm Поделиться сообщением Ссылка на сообщение
Хазард #58 15 января 2013 Option Compare Database Option Explicit Option Base 1 '3,1,5,7,2 --> 1,5,7,2,3 Public TestArray() As Variant Public Sub T() Call FillArray(TestArray()) Call ShiftArray(TestArray()) End Sub Public Sub FillArray(ByRef InputArray() As Variant) Const l As Long = 5 ReDim InputArray(l) Dim i As Long i = i + 1: InputArray(i) = 3 i = i + 1: InputArray(i) = 1 i = i + 1: InputArray(i) = 5 i = i + 1: InputArray(i) = 7 i = i + 1: InputArray(i) = 2 End Sub Public Sub ShiftArray(ByRef InputArray() As Variant) Dim i_min As Long Dim i_max As Long Dim i As Long i_min = LBound(InputArray()) i_max = UBound(InputArray()) Dim v_min As Variant Dim v_max As Variant Dim v As Variant v_min = InputArray(i_min) v_max = InputArray(i_max) 'Debug.Print ya sosala 100 huev, v_min, v_max For i = i_min To i_max Select Case i Case i_max: v = v_min Case Else: v = InputArray(i + 1) End Select InputArray(i) = v 'Debug.Print v_min, v_max, v, InputArray(i) Next End Sub попробуй так. Поделиться сообщением Ссылка на сообщение
Roachen #59 15 января 2013 '3,1,5,7,2 --> 1,5,7,2,3 - это убери в какой строке еррор?бля не смешно, мне уже вот вот программу показывать, а вы тут шуточки шутитеКак будто всем не похуй. Поделиться сообщением Ссылка на сообщение
~Sofi #60 15 января 2013 '3,1,5,7,2 --> 1,5,7,2,3 - это убери в какой строке еррор?бля не смешно, мне уже вот вот программу показывать, а вы тут шуточки шутитеКак будто всем не похуй.ты вообще кто? Поделиться сообщением Ссылка на сообщение